#585544 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#585544 is composed of 34.5% red, 33.3%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.4% magenta, 22.7%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 51 degrees, a saturation of 12.8% and a lightness of 30.6%. #585544 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0aa88 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#585544 color description : Very dark grayish yellow.
#585544 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#585544 has RGB values of R:88, G:85,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.23,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5788996.
